Job Overview

The Director of Structured Finance Ratings plays a pivotal role in evaluating complex financial transactions, encompassing innovative asset classes and issuers. As part of a high-performing team of analysts, this individual will be responsible for rating new transactions across various asset classes within the Australian and New Zealand structured finance markets.

Main Responsibilities:
  • Leverage expertise to guide the rating process for highly complex transactions, including those involving novel asset classes and issuers.
  • Provide mentorship and support to team members throughout the execution of new transactions and ongoing surveillance.
  • Manage workflow to ensure timely review of all structured finance transactions and covered bond programs on a continuous 12-month basis.
  • Promote high-quality analytical documentation and effectively present findings in committee meetings.
  • Offer insightful commentary on market and transaction performance.
Key Qualifications:
  • Demonstrated expertise in securitisation markets.
  • A minimum of 7+ years' experience in structured finance, preferably in a credit or analytical capacity.
  • Proven ability in one or more areas: credit analysis and proposal memo preparation, structuring advice and deal execution, legal review of transaction documents, cash flow modeling of securitisation transactions.
  • Excellent communication skills, with proficiency in report writing.
  • Intermediate to advanced Microsoft Office skills, particularly Excel.
  • Superior time management and attention to detail.
